U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ission
The U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ission (NRC) located at 7821 River Road, Waynesboro, Georgia, is a pivotal federal agency dedicated to ensuring the safe use of radioactive materials for beneficial civilian purposes while protecting people and the environment. As a vital component of the nation's regulatory framework, the NRC oversees the operation of nuclear power plants and other nuclear facilities, ensuring compliance with stringent safety standards and regulations. Our Waynesboro office plays a critical role in monitoring and inspecting local nuclear activities, providing guidance, and fostering transparency and public trust through community engagement.
